Two engines, one for the reverb and one for effects.
We can therefore use a reverb effect + 1 simultaneously.

2 jacks for input, 2 outputs.
Can connect a pedal on it (the G-Minor, for example ...)

Possibility of the two motors in parallel and in series. Handy to get a mono signal so that it is split and then treated in stereo.

UTILIZATION

The régalges of reverbs and effects are very practical and well detailed in the doc.
The knobs are super efficient and you really spend time to find her!
Not very plug 'n play, but effective.
No régalges level in effect, you must play with a button mix of reverb and effect and between fact Malange Treaty and pure ... Not very practical.

SOUND QUALITY

Outstanding!

TC quality is there. The reverbs are splendid. The editing takes time, but it's worth it. We are far from reverbs to my v-amp pro where you turn, you play. There must be time and a very fine set.

Ditto for the delays which are superb. Very specific, very effective.
The chorus is also very pretty. Some reproach him a little lack of presence, but it does its business. The exact opposite of the one I had on my digitech S100 which was very clean and present. This one is organic and fairly unobtrusive. I love it!
Phaser, Vintage Phaser and Flanger are two success stories!

OVERALL OPINION

In short, it is far from the multi-effects with chaining a lot, but for the price where it is found to OCCAZ, it allows caller in a 1U high quality reverb and full effect at least equal quality (with keys different, of course) is what we find in a Boss unit € 100.

Perfect for home recording, but also on stage (no hollow of a preset to another, and the delay is not cut).
